Job Purpose
Reporting to the Project Director, the senior MEP Engineer is responsible for the efficient planning, coordination, execution, and delivery of all Mechanical, Electrical, and Plumbing (MEP) aspects of assigned residential buildings and villa projects. The role ensures that all MEP works are completed on time, within budget, and to the required standards of quality and compliance, in alignment with DarGlobal’s development goals.
Key Responsibilities:
- Develop, plan, and implement MEP project scopes, timelines, budgets, and technical specifications in coordination with architectural and civil project components.
- Lead cross-functional teams and manage relationships with stakeholders to ensure project success.
- Manage and supervise MEP works on site, ensuring adherence to project specifications, codes, and best practices.
- Conduct technical reviews of contractor submissions, shop drawings, method statements, and material approvals.
- Conduct risk assessments and create contingency plans to mitigate potential challenges.
- Regularly communicate project status, progress, and challenges to stakeholders, including senior management.
- Collaborate with architects, engineers, and contractors to ensure project timelines and budgets are met.
- Monitor project financials and make recommendations to adjust resources and timelines as needed.
- Ensure projects are delivered on time, within budget, and to the satisfaction of stakeholders.
- Stay up-to-date on industry trends and regulations to ensure projects are compliant.
- Mentor and train team members to improve their project management skills.
- Responsible for the daily management, supervision, coordination and successful completion of projects to meet time and cost objectives.
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ree in mechanical engineering.
- A minimum of 5 years of experience in MEP project management, with a focus on real estate residential building projects.
- Strong leadership and interpersonal skills.
